Howard County, Texas Census 2020 Total Hispanic and Non-Hispanic Voting-age Population (18yrs and over)

Updated on August 22, 2023.

According to the data from the US 2020 decennial Census, as at April 2020, among the total 26,862 of the Howard County, TX voting-age population (18 years and over), 14,877 identified as non-Hispanic (55.38%), and 11,985 identified as Hispanic or Latino (44.62%).
